The Core Differences: Cuisinart TOA-65 vs Breville BOV900BSS

The most immediate thing I noticed when unboxing these is the scale. The Cuisinart TOA-65 is a vertical, compact powerhouse designed to maximize air frying. The Breville BOV900BSS (The Smart Oven Air Fryer Pro) is a much wider, more professional-grade machine that aims to be a second oven rather than just a toaster.

Detailed Comparative Review: My Experience

Design and Countertop Presence

When I cleared space for the Breville BOV900BSS, I quickly realized it’s a “statement” piece. It’s wide—really wide. If you have low-hanging cabinets, you’ll need to be careful because this unit generates a significant amount of heat from the top. However, the brushed stainless steel finish and the heavy-duty dials feel incredibly premium. The LCD screen is bright and changes color (blue to orange) when it’s actively heating, which is a visual cue I grew to love.

The Cuisinart TOA-65, by contrast, is the “space-saver.” It’s taller rather than wider, which I found much more practical for my smaller prep area. Despite the smaller footprint, it still feels sturdy. One design win for Cuisinart is the large viewing window—it’s easier to see your food browning in this unit than in the Breville, mostly because the light is positioned perfectly to illuminate the air fry basket.

Performance: Air Frying vs. Precision Baking

This is where the two machines really show their true colors.

  • The Cuisinart TOA-65 is an Air Fryer first. In my tests, the high-velocity fan in this unit is louder but more effective at “flash-crisping.” When I threw in three pounds of frozen fries, they came out with that signature snap in about 15 minutes. The “Dual Cook” function is also a game-changer; I’ve used it to start a roast at a high temp for a sear and then automatically drop to a lower temp to finish—no manual intervention needed.
  • The Breville BOV900BSS is a Gourmet Oven first. The Element iQ system is significantly more sophisticated than the Cuisinart’s heating coils. It uses five independent quartz elements that move heat to where it’s needed most. When I baked a batch of delicate chocolate chip cookies, they were perfectly even across the tray—no “hot spots” that usually plague smaller ovens. While it can air fry, the larger internal cavity means it takes a few minutes longer to get things as crispy as the Cuisinart.

Ease of Use and Cleaning

I found the Breville to be the more intuitive of the two. The screen tells you exactly which rack position to use for each function (Rack 1, 2, or 3). It’s almost impossible to mess up. However, the mesh air fry basket that comes with the Breville is a nightmare to clean if you’re doing something greasy like wings.

The Cuisinart is simpler to maintain. Its interior is non-stick, and I found that most splatters wiped away with just a damp cloth. Plus, the Cuisinart’s baking pan is a bit more durable—I didn’t notice the same warping at high temperatures that I’ve seen in cheaper models.

The Verdict: My Recommendation

Choosing between the Cuisinart TOA-65 vs Breville BOV900BSS comes down to your daily habits.

Go with the Cuisinart TOA-65 if you are primarily looking for an elite air fryer that can also toast and bake. It’s the perfect choice for busy families who need nuggets, fries, and quick snacks on the table in record time without sacrificing counter space.

Go with the Breville BOV900BSS if you are a serious home cook or baker. If you find your main oven is often full, or if you want a machine that can handle professional-grade roasting and dehydrating, the Breville is worth every extra penny. It’s less of a “toaster” and more of a “culinary workstation.”

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Can the Breville BOV900BSS really replace a regular oven?

A: For about 90% of tasks, yes. It fits a 9×13 inch pan and a standard Dutch oven. Unless you are baking multiple trays of cookies at once, it’s just as capable as a full-sized range.

Q: Is the Cuisinart TOA-65 loud?

A: It is louder than a standard toaster oven because of the high-velocity fan required for air frying. However, it’s quieter than most standalone basket-style air fryers I’ve tested.

Q: Can I dehydrate food in both models?

A: Yes, both have dehydration settings. However, the Breville is superior for this because it can fit up to four racks at once (sold separately), whereas the Cuisinart is limited by its vertical height.

Q: Which one is easier for a beginner to use?

A: The Breville is more “helpful” because of its LCD screen and rack-positioning guides, while the Cuisinart is more “straightforward”—you just turn the dial to the function and hit start.
